Bangalore based Kuliza receives strategic investment from Blume Ventures

Kuliza is a Bangalore based software development company founded in September 2006. The company builds web, mobile and social media experiences for Indian and global clients and in an announcement today, has received a strategic investment from Blume Ventures, a Mumbai fund.


Kuliza

Kuliza, experienced in delivering digital apps and solutions to major global brands such as EBay India, Intuit, Van Heusen, Pearson, Whirlpool and Myntra, will use the funds for global expansion and the development of new digital marketing tools.

Kuliza recently appointed Kaushal Sarda as CEO. Prior to joining Kuliza, Kaushal managed the Bangalore office of ‘2020 Social’ - a leading social business strategy firm, which was acquired by Publicis.

“Blume is excited to make a strategic investment into Kuliza. We are impressed with Kuliza’s strong team of agile developers and their high rate of customer retention; they obviously understand how to delight clients," said Karthik Reddy, Managing Partner at Blume Ventures.
